Aperture controls depth of the Field. What's Depth of the Field?
Distance in an image where objects appear acceptably in focus
If you want to freeze motion, which shutter speed would be better, 1/60 or 1/1000?
1/1000
3 things that control exposure
ISO, Shutter Speed, Aperture

Whats the definition of ISO?
Rating of sensitivity of the sensor to light
Definition of Aperature
The diameter of the lense opening
Definition of Shutter Speed?
The amount of time the shutter is open
As your ISO increases, what happens to ur image?
It gets grainy and brighter
Ho do photographers refer to different aperture settings?
F-Stops
How do you measure shutter speed?
Seconds or fractions of seconds
If your photographing in broad daylight outside, which ISO value should you use, ISO 100 or ISO 1000
ISO 100
Which aperture numbers let in more light, smaller number f-stops or larger number f-stops?
Smaller numbers
What does shutter speed also allow photographer to control besides exposure?
Stop action and blur motion
Whats bracketing?
Taking the same photo at different exposures
